‘Majorca here I come!’ Eoghan McDermott announces major Love Island role

He’s well-known for his massively popular 2fm show.

However, Eoghan McDermott has a new gig for the summer – and one that involves jetting off to Majorca to work with ITV‘s reality TV smash-hit, Love Island.

The 35-year-old Limerick-man took to Instagram on Friday evening to share the exciting news with his 43K followers.

He wrote:

“Majorca here I come! Delighted to be joining the @itvstudios family as the narrator of Love Island Australia!”

Love Island Australia is debuting this year following the massive success of the UK offering and will follow a similar format.

It will air on 9Go – an Aussie digital station – but hopefully will also be available to us here in Ireland.

Eoghan added in the same Insta post: “I sat up one night at the kitchen table months ago writing the audition script & had such a blast.”

He furthermore referenced Iain Stirling – who famously lends his voice to the UK series – saying he is “such a huge reason the show was a success”.

Eoghan concluded: “I’m chuffed that the Oz crew liked what I was at and it’s actually come to pass. Gonna be a hectic & brilliant summer!”

The Oz series will be presented by Sophie Monk, who is a pretty big name in her native Australia.
